Abstract

Kuala Selangor Nature Park has the potential to be packaged as a learning resource to increase environmental literacy through the Experiential and Joyfull Learning-Marine Edutourism (EJoy-ME) learning model. The purpose of this activity is to implement EJoy-ME for Kuala Lumpur Indonesian School students to increase environmental literacy. Activities focused on the open mind EJoy-ME model for SIKL teachers, developing learning tools based on the potential of the Kuala Selangor Nature Park mangrove ecosystem, and implementing EJoy-ME according to the syntax. The implementation of EJoy-ME has proven to be able to increase the environmental literacy of Kuala Lumpur Indonesian School students. This also gets a positive response from students, namely providing environmental material satisfaction, location selection, satisfaction of the learning process.
